English Language Arts
- The grade 8 child learned how to effectively format and structure a support request using proper language and tone.
- Through this activity, the child practiced articulating their thoughts and concerns in a clear and concise manner.
- The child developed their understanding of audience and purpose in written communication, tailoring the support request to the specific needs of Epic Games.
- Engaging in this activity also allowed the child to enhance their digital literacy skills by composing a typed document.
Encourage the child to further develop their written communication skills by exploring different types of writing such as persuasive essays or creative storytelling. They can also practice researching and incorporating evidence to support their claims, which will strengthen their persuasive writing abilities.
